Overview

As the capstone of this series of units, your learning activities will focus on the synthesis of all the skills you have acquired through the previous five units. You will be expected to perform to a high standard in a range of practical work that exhibits cumulative learning in all performance elements for the music theatre singer. At this advanced level, a greater degree of insight and personal reflection, as evidenced through practice, is expected. You will study complex aspects of vocal technique in your development as a music theatre singer with an advanced exploration of music theatre vocal repertoire. As part of your singing technique, you will explore the phonetic aspects of the French and Mandarin languages in selected songs. This will be supported by more advanced levels of music theory, including aspects of song-writing and arranging, aural musicianship and piano keyboard for your development as a music theatre singer.
